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Huntly to Battlesbridge start from as little as £46.90

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Huntly to Battlesbridge start from £107.40 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Huntly to Battlesbridge are available for £136.10 one way

Station Facilities

Huntly Station offers an array of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The ticket office is open from 06:50 to 13:54, Monday through Saturday, providing ample time to purchase your tickets. If you prefer the convenience of buying your tickets online, you can easily collect them at the station's ticket machines, which are also equipped to serve passengers with accessibility needs.

Accessibility is taken seriously at Huntly, with step-free access available to most parts of the station. The station is categorized as a Category B station, featuring level access to platforms, though be mindful of potential larger gaps between train and platform. For anyone requiring assistance, staff help is readily available on weekdays, along with help points throughout the station.

Although there aren't any refreshing food and drink outlets or ATMs, the station is equipped with essential services to ensure a comfortable wait. The waiting rooms are open in line with ticket office hours, and there are seating areas available should you wish to rest. Luggage storage isn't offered, but CCTV throughout the station contributes to a secure environment for all passengers.

Accessibility and Parking

The station encourages both eco-friendly and convenient travel options. Bicycle stands are sheltered and ready for your cycling journey. There are 27 car parking spaces available, including accessible spaces, with the bonus of free parking 24 hours a day. Station Facilities and Accessibility

Battlesbridge train station may not boast a ticket office, but it does feature ticket machines that are equipped for online ticket collection and accept smartcard validations. Perfect for independent travelers, the station provides crucial accessibility facilities including step-free access across its single platform, making it compliant with the Office of Rail and Road's classification as a Category A station. There is a ramp for train access and seating available on-site, enhancing the ease of navigation for all passengers. However, amenities such as waiting rooms, restrooms, and refreshment facilities are not available – a common feature of smaller stations.

Transport Connectivity and Onward Travel

On your arrival at Battlesbridge, transport does not end on the rail. While it is not served by a rail replacement service, the station's central location in Essex ensures easy access to alternative travel forms such as taxis, though they must be pre-arranged. For cycling enthusiasts, bicycle storage is available with ten spots, albeit uncovered.
